Something exciting this week was that I found out I am zoned for Helensville birth care for postpartum care which is super exciting, so we are registering for the two days offered there post our hospital birth (of course its if everything goes smoothly, but plan for the best I say!) Its something I have really wanted to try and do and is highly recommended to me from other mamas (but also can be super expensive if you are out of zone so I was starting to fret about it all hence why this news had me SO excited). What it means is if available when we have baby myself and Nic get to stay together with bubs the first night and have the support of the staff who teach you how to latch/feed baby, a rough newborn schedule and what to look out for etc followed by another night for mama and baby. In my eyes it just sets you up to get the best start as a first time new mama (of course we are built to do this so if it doesn't happen I won't mind I would just prefer it this way.)
